The HVD series of degasifiers uses the only known method for reducing all three primary contaminants by treating the transformer oil; the thermo-vacuum process. This results in a decrease in water, gas and particulate contamination and an increase in the dielectric strength of transformer oil.

The TOLMS, Transformer Oil Level Monitoring System is a system that can be retro-fitted to existing degasifiers, from Redragon or others, to provide a means of processing oil on energized transformers.
The Series DBPC Anti-Oxidant Inhibitor System is a complete system that can be retro-fitted to any make or model of high vacuum degasifier or regeneration system. It allows for the addition of an anti-oxidant inhibitor to a transformer during the oil treatment phase of transformer maintenance.
